The rise of online sports betting during the World Cup in Canada

The FIFA World Cup 2022 was a significant event for gambling, as the tournament saw a surge in engagement. According to leading providers, the competition, which lasted for a couple of weeks, recorded over $2 billion globally, with a notable 21% increase in gambling reported in Canada. The Canadian team may have exited in the group stages, but their performances generated a buzz among fans and helped increase wagering activity. With the 2026 edition set to be hosted jointly in North America, the rise of football betting sites in Canada is expected to continue.

Changes in odds throughout the tournament

In their first appearance since 1986, Canada put up a spirited fight against second-ranked Belgium, creating increased interest in Ontario’s legal sports-betting market. While many sportsbooks listed Belgium as the clear favorite, with a win paying out anywhere from -175 to -105, the Canadian team was listed at +475 to +280 for the win. Although the country had been eliminated after losing to Croatia, operators at the best football betting sites still saw increased game demand.

Legalization and regulation of sports betting in Canada

In 2018, the Supreme Court lifted the ban on gaming. This gave individual provinces the authority to regulate and license it within their jurisdiction. It created a legal framework for online gaming, making it safer and more secure for users. Additionally, the legalization of sports wagering has resulted in increased tax revenue for the government.
